M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


3 participantes

    [Resolvido]selecionar primeiro nome

    avatar
    AErmel
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 91
    Registrado : 27/01/2012

    [Resolvido]selecionar primeiro nome Empty [Resolvido]selecionar primeiro nome

    Mensagem  AErmel 9/8/2014, 13:12

    Boas

    Gostaria de saber se é possível: Apos preencher o nome do funcionário, em outro campo trazer apenas o primeiro nome a partir do nome completo.

    exemplo
    Campo 1 - João Paulo da Silva
    No evento apos atualizar, o Campo 2 deve retornar - João


    obrigado
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8498
    Registrado : 05/11/2009

    [Resolvido]selecionar primeiro nome Empty Re: [Resolvido]selecionar primeiro nome

    Mensagem  Alexandre Neves 9/8/2014, 14:24

    Boa tarde,
    Dê continuidade ao pendente http://maximoaccess.forumeiros.com/t15128-retirar-espacos-vazios#114834
    Nomeie de forma normalizada
    Sobre esta dúvida, coloque Mid(Campo1,instr(1,campo1," ")-1)


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o
    avatar
    AErmel
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 91
    Registrado : 27/01/2012

    [Resolvido]selecionar primeiro nome Empty Re: [Resolvido]selecionar primeiro nome

    Mensagem  AErmel 9/8/2014, 15:36

    Boa tarde Alexandre
    Obrigado por retornar..

    Quanto a dar continuidade ao pendente , sinceramente não entendi, pois são dois problemas distintos.
    este atual é para retornar o primeiro nome
    O antigo é para retirar todos espaços vazios existentes ao fim do nome.
    Talvez o que o amigo queira dizer seria renomear o topico com: "Retirar espaços vazios ao fim do nome"
    se for isto, alterarei

    Voltando a este topico
    Apliquei conforme indicado e:
    No campo1 apos digitar João Paulo da Silva , o campo2 deu o seguinte retorno: o da silva
    por curiosidade alterei para Mid(Campo1,instr(1,campo1," ")+1) o campo2 deu o seguinte retorno: Paulo da Silva

    o que preciso é que retorne João


    obrigado







    Alvaro Teixeira
    Alvaro Teixeira
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7996
    Registrado : 15/03/2013

    [Resolvido]selecionar primeiro nome Empty Re: [Resolvido]selecionar primeiro nome

    Mensagem  Alvaro Teixeira 9/8/2014, 16:28

    Olá,

    exprimente: Left(Campo1,instr(1,campo1," ")-1)
    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8498
    Registrado : 05/11/2009

    [Resolvido]selecionar primeiro nome Empty Re: [Resolvido]selecionar primeiro nome

    Mensagem  Alexandre Neves 9/8/2014, 16:34

    Fiz-lhe o código sem testar. Veja se o do colega teixeira serve. Caso contrário, avise
    Sobre o outro assunto, sei que não é mesma dúvida mas há tanto tempo sem haver evolução. Já resolveu ou está a aguardar solução?


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o
    Alvaro Teixeira
    Alvaro Teixeira
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 7996
    Registrado : 15/03/2013

    [Resolvido]selecionar primeiro nome Empty Re: [Resolvido]selecionar primeiro nome

    Mensagem  Alvaro Teixeira 9/8/2014, 16:39

    Olá a todos

    Acho que o exemplo que o colega Alexandre tentava exemplificar é:

    Mid([Campo1],1,InStr([campo1]," ")-1)

    Que também se obtem o pretendido.

    Um abraço a todos
    avatar
    AErmel
    Intermediário
    Intermediário


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 91
    Registrado : 27/01/2012

    [Resolvido]selecionar primeiro nome Empty Re: [Resolvido]selecionar primeiro nome

    Mensagem  AErmel 9/8/2014, 19:00

    boa tarde Alexandre e Teixeira

    Perfeito funcionou como esperado. Retorna o primeiro nome.

    Quanto ao outro tópico, realmente não consegui a solução.
    se puder dar uma ajuda, agradeço
    Vou renomear o tópico para "Retirar espaços vazios ao fim do nome"

    Obrigado a ambos

    Conteúdo patrocinado


    [Resolvido]selecionar primeiro nome Empty Re: [Resolvido]selecionar primeiro nome

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 21/11/2024, 20:36